Post » Mon May 28, 2012 10:39 pm

This just happened to me. I had just leveled one-handed up to 77 clearing out a cave. I walked a little way down the road, got attacked by a saber cat, and killed it. I came across a small camp, which had a one-handed skill book, boosting me to 78. Then I find a dungeon, made a save and went in. I ran into a couple of mages just inside and while fighting them sometihng else leveled up, but I didn't see what it was. I brought up the skill menu and saw my one-handed in red at 15. I loaded the save from before entering the dungeon and it was in red at 15 there too. The auto save from when I exited the cave was fine.

It appears to be just a display glitch, it's not actually 15. If you zoom in on the perk tree, it shows the correct skill next to the required skill for unlocking a perk. However, using the console command "player.getav onehanded" does return 15, but if it were actually 15, I would not be chopping heads off high level characters.

Since it's just a display glitch, ignore it and keep playing until it levels up on its own. If you want it fixed without waiting, you can use the console command "player.modav XX" and replace XX with the level it should be at. You won't lose your progress toward the next level either.

I played with the console commands, and they work. However, since it was only 8 minutes between when I noticed it and the last save, I loaded the save and re-traced my steps and it didn't happen again.
